Patent number: 10447733Abstract: Methods, systems, and apparatus, including computer programs encoded on computer storage media, for implementing deception networks. One of the systems includes a threat information server configured to monitor and control security threats, a management process orchestration server configured to receive one or more identified security threats from the threat information server and develop a response process applicable to each identified security threat, a network switching controller in communication with one or more network switching devices, a target computing device connected to one of the network switching devices, and an indicator analytics processor configured to generate threat intelligence based on activity observed on the target device and provide the observed threat intelligence to the threat information server. The threat information server can receive threat intelligence information, identify key indicators, and generate identified security threats.Type: GrantFiled: August 29, 2014Date of Patent: October 15, 2019Assignee: Accenture Global Services LimitedInventors: Louis William DiValentin, Matthew Carver, Michael L. Patent number: 10437709Abstract: A device may receive configuration information for an experiment associated with optimizing an application. The configuration information may identify a group of experimental treatments and information identifying a target event. The device may identify an experimental treatment to be implemented in the application, and may implement the experimental treatment in the application. The device may collect response information based on implementing the experimental treatment. The device may detect the target event associated with the experiment, indicating that the response information is to be provided to an experiment server. The device may determine that the experiment server is unreachable and may store the response information. The response information may be stored to allow the response information to be provided to the experiment server at a later time. The response information may be provided to the experiment server to permit the experiment server to determine a result of the experiment.Type: GrantFiled: September 26, 2016Date of Patent: October 8, 2019Assignee: Accenture Global Services LimitedInventor: Murray Williams

Patent number: 10438297Abstract: A platform may obtain, for a first set of entities involved in a money laundering investigation, target entity information for a target entity and related entity information for a set of related entities. The platform may analyze the target entity information and the related entity information to identify money laundering candidates. The platform may determine one or more relationships indicating a degree of similarity between the target entity and the one or more related entities. The platform may generate a graph data structure that associates the target entity and the one or more related entities using the one or more relationships. The platform may determine a score for the target entity and one or more scores for the one or more related entities. The platform may provide a recommendation indicating whether the target entity and/or the one or more related entities are likely to be engaging in money laundering.Type: GrantFiled: June 19, 2017Date of Patent: October 8, 2019Assignee: Accenture Global Solutions LimitedInventors: Jingguang Han, Md Faisal Zaman, Dadong Wan, Alejandro Cabello Jimenez, Esteban Collado Cespon

Patent number: 10438118Abstract: A device may receive, from a user device, a request to verify a machine learning (ML) application using a metamorphic testing procedure. The device may determine a type of ML process used by the ML application, and may select one or more metamorphic relations (MRs), to be used for performing the metamorphic testing procedure, based on the type of ML process. The device may receive test data to be used to test the ML application, wherein the test data is based on the one or more MRs, and may perform, by using the one or more MRs and the test data, the metamorphic testing procedure to verify one or more aspects of the ML application. The device may generate a report that indicates whether the one or more aspects of the ML application have been verified and may provide the report for display on an interface of the user device.Type: GrantFiled: September 28, 2018Date of Patent: October 8, 2019Assignee: Accenture Global Solutions LimitedInventors: Anurag Dwarakanath, Sanjay Podder, Neville Dubash, Kishore P Durg, Manish Ahuja, Raghotham M Rao, Samarth Sikand, Jagadeesh Chandra Bose Rantham Prabhakara

Publication number: 20190305950Abstract: Systems and methods for active state synchronization between distributed ledger technology (DLT) platforms are provided. A system may store an origin blockchain compliant with an origin DLT. The system may further store a target blockchain compliant with a target DLT. The target DLT may be different from the origin DLT. The system may include a DLT object synchronizer with access to the origin blockchain and the target blockchain. The DLT object synchronizer may receive, from an exchange node, a request to synchronize an origin instance of a DLT object between the origin blockchain and the target blockchain. The DLT object synchronizer may select a target instance of the DLT object on the target blockchain. The DLT object synchronizer may format origin data from the origin instance for compliance with the target DLT. The DLT object synchronizer may synchronize the origin instance and the target instance.Type: ApplicationFiled: August 30, 2018Publication date: October 3, 2019Applicant: Accenture Global Solutions LimitedInventors: David Treat, Giuseppe Giordano, Luca Schiatti, Hugo Borne-Pons

Patent number: 10430323Abstract: Methods, systems, and apparatus, including computer programs encoded on a computer storage medium, for a touchless testing platform employed to, for example, create automated testing scripts, sequence test cases, and implement determine defect solutions. In one aspect, a method includes the actions of receiving a log file that includes log records generated from a code base; processing the log file through a pattern mining algorithm to determine a usage pattern; generating a graphical representation based on an analysis of the usage pattern; processing the graphical representation through a machine learning algorithm to select a set of test cases from a plurality of test cases for the code base and to assign a priority value to each of the selected test cases; sequencing the set of test cases based on the priority values; and transmitting the sequenced set of test cases to a test execution engine.Type: GrantFiled: September 10, 2018Date of Patent: October 1, 2019Assignee: Accenture Global Solutions LimitedInventors: Mahesh Venkata Raman, Sunder Nochilur Ranganathan, Mallika Fernandes, Kulkarni Girish, Chinmaya Ranjan Jena, Jothi Gouthaman, Venugopal S. Patent number: 10430693Abstract: A piping and instrumentation planning and maintenance system includes an input/output (I/O) interface for receiving a target piping and instrumentation diagram (PID) from a document source system; a processor in communication with the I/O interface; and non-transitory computer readable media in communication with the processor. The non-transitory computer readable media store instruction code, which when executed by the processor, causes the processor to classify entities and properties thereof within the target PID. The entities include one or more assets and interconnections therebetween specified in the PID. The processor compares the classified entities to a knowledge base that represents relationships between a plurality of assets and interconnections between the assets. The processor then determines, based on the comparison, whether the assets in the target PID are interconnected correctly.Type: GrantFiled: March 8, 2019Date of Patent: October 1, 2019Assignee: Accenture Global Solutions LimitedInventors: Teresa Sheausan Tung, Jean-Luc Chatelain, Jurgen Albert Weichenberger, Ishmeet Singh Grewal
